Output 3deaeb02d91be9e095f91eac28e7e0b6e3e1cc2d45f59b42e4731b6865501636:19

value
1072206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c46ec306cbb92a49bc480f68190492b3ce5e19f OP_EQUAL
address
3D28g7w3SSjbdfr9FTf1RtwcdXJ963iP2M
transaction
3deaeb02d91be9e095f91eac28e7e0b6e3e1cc2d45f59b42e4731b6865501636
spent
true